a pair of chinese famille verte porcelain vases, bronze mounted and adapted as oil lamps, last quarter 19th century
The waisted necks rising to reveal internal reservoirs, above tapering bodies, decorated with Chinese figures, with pierced burners and on guilloche pierced circular bases, adapted, the French mounts re-gilt
20¾in. (53cm.) high, excluding fitment (2)
